summ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orSilvio Rhatto <rhatto@riseup.net>2013-01-19 16:11:13 -0200
committerSilvio Rhatto <rhatto@riseup.net>2013-01-19 16:11:13 -0200
commitb1313ab42a83c926cccb724a322285044e02271c (patch)
tree68542bbc0912d11623adf05b5d57ba2692e0f3f7
parente7a621dbfecc2c04bda844faf4be07e7a3655972 (diff)
downloadpuppet-wordpress-b1313ab42a83c926cccb724a322285044e02271c.tar.gz
puppet-wordpress-b1313ab42a83c926cccb724a322285044e02271c.tar.bz2
Upgrading for 2.7 compatibility --config
-rw-r--r--manifests/init.pp16
-rw-r--r--templates/wordpress.sh.erb2
2 files changed, 6 insertions, 12 deletions
diff --git a/manifests/init.pp b/manifests/init.pp
index aa24593..a433910 100644
--- a/manifests/init.pp
+++ b/manifests/init.pp
@@ -1,15 +1,9 @@
-class wordpress {
+class wordpress(
+ $folder = ${apache::www_folder},
+ $locale = ''
+) {
- case $wordpress_folder {
- '' : {
- case $apache_www_folder {
- '': { fail("you need to define \$apache_www_folder for wordpress module") }
- default: { $wordpress_folder = $apache_www_folder }
- }
- }
- }
-
- $real_wordpress_locale = $wordpress_locale ? {
+ $real_wordpress_locale = $locale ? {
'' => '',
default => "-${wordpress_locale}"
}
diff --git a/templates/wordpress.sh.erb b/templates/wordpress.sh.erb
index 41d739f..826dc82 100644
--- a/templates/wordpress.sh.erb
+++ b/templates/wordpress.sh.erb
@@ -3,7 +3,7 @@
# wordpress management script.
#
-BASE="<%= wordpress_folder %>"
+BASE="<%= folder %>"
LOCALE="<%= real_wordpress_locale %>"
# Set alternative base